About BBPOS
BBPOS is one of the world leaders in payment devices and the inventors of mPOS technology. BBPOS products are used by large retailers and leading online platforms across multiple industries. BBPOS is engaged in the business of manufacturing and supplying mobile and smart point-of-sale hardware, and the underlying software and infrastructure to deploy, manage, and monitor those devices. BBPOS is now part of Stripe’s Terminal business since the acquisition in March 2022
About Stripe Terminal
Post acquisition, the BBPOS team is now an extension of the Stripe Terminal team. Stripe Terminal helps Stripe users extend their online presence into the physical world. The Terminal team’s mission is to make it as easy for businesses to accept in-person payments. With Terminal, businesses can unlock in-person payments use cases that are right for their business model—whether it’s creating a flagship retail experience, extending their website to a pop-up store, or enabling a mobile point-of-sale at their next event.
